Arrive in Hanoi and meet your private guide and driver for a seamless transfer to your hotel in the atmospheric Old Quarter. Begin your Vietnam travel experience at an unhurried pace, with time to rest and recover from jet lag or enjoy a gentle afternoon stroll through nearby streets.
An optional evening walk offers the chance to sample local street food and ease into the city’s vibrant rhythm.

Drive from your hotel through historic Ba Dinh Square, where President Ho Chi Minh declared independence in 1945, then pause at Lenin Garden for people watching. Wander through traditional sewing alleys before visiting the Temple of Literature and the Ethnology Museum.
Enjoy lunch at a local restaurant, stroll the Old Quarter and lively Nha Chung Market, and pause for tea at a historic French-era house while hearing family stories. Conclude the day with a traditional water puppet performance.

Meet your guide in the morning for a tailor-made countryside journey to Ba Vi and Ri Village. At a local tea plantation, share tea and stories with Mr Duoc as you learn the art of hand-picking and traditional tea processing.
Continue to Moc Village for a hands-on cooking class with Mrs Chin, enjoying the meal you prepare in a lush tropical garden. Later, stroll through the village to observe tofu making and the crafting of conical hats, then cycle gently through rice paddies.
End the day with a soothing Muong ethnic minority herbal foot soak before returning to Hanoi.

A scenic transfer from Hanoi to Mai Chau reveals limestone karsts, patchwork rice fields, and stilted White Thai villages. Arrive in Mai Chau, Hoa Binh Province, one of the best places to visit in Vietnam for authentic mountain culture, and check into your hotel.
Enjoy a guided village walk through rice valleys and stilt houses, meeting the White Thai community and learning traditional brocade weaving and local handicrafts through tailor-made cultural exchanges.
Lunch is served en route, followed by time to relax in the poetic valley before an overnight stay in Mai Chau.

Travel by private transfer from Mai Chau to Pu Luong, passing through peaceful valleys and emerald rice terraces. Enjoy a guided walk in Pu Luong Nature Reserve along shaded trails that descend into a scenic valley facing the retreat and cascade past tumbling rice fields.
Continue trekking beside ponds, rivers, and farmland to reach Uoi Village, set at the base of a towering mountain, with ever-changing views and rich flora and fauna along the way. Lunch is served at a traditional stilt house before returning to your hotel.

Transfer from Pu Luong to Ninh Binh this morning, passing sweeping rice terraces and dramatic karst landscapes. This segment of your Vietnam itinerary is designed for comfort and flexibility, allowing time to pause for photos and brief encounters with local farmers.
On arrival, Ninh Binh’s limestone peaks and flooded valleys unfold before you. Enjoy lunch at a local restaurant, then continue to Van Long, the region’s largest wetland nature reserve, home to 32 grottos and seasonal migratory birds.
Glide by a small row boat through still waters beneath towering cliffs, guided by a local rower.

After breakfast, visit Hoa Lu, Vietnam’s first centralized feudal capital, and explore the Dinh and Le temples set among rice paddies. Continue to Tam Coc, often called “Ha Long Bay on Land,” and glide by small boat through three limestone caves, including the Dancing Cave, for close-up karst views.
End the day with a climb up Mua Mountain’s nearly 500 stone steps to a hilltop shrine dedicated to Quan Am, rewarded with sweeping panoramas across the valley.

After breakfast in Ninh Binh, drive to the emerald waters of Ha Long Bay, where thousands of limestone islands rise in sculpted formations. Board your private cruise and enjoy lunch as you glide into the dramatic karst seascape.
The afternoon offers guided cave visits, kayaking, or time to relax on deck. As evening falls, the ship anchors among the limestone towers for dinner and an overnight stay on board.

Sunrise over Ha Long Bay reveals layers of limestone karsts as breakfast or brunch is served on board during the return cruise to port. Enjoy kayaking, exploring hidden grottoes, or joining a gentle Tai Chi session on deck.
Back in Hanoi, settle into your Old Quarter hotel and enjoy a private walking tour with street food tastings and locally guided experiences tailored to your interests.

Enjoy a relaxed breakfast at your hotel, followed by a free morning in Hanoi to soak up local life. Choose a tailor-made experience, such as a private coffee tasting, a guided stroll through the Old Quarter, or last-minute market shopping to gather final memories.
When ready, a private transfer will take you to Noi Bai International Airport for your onward flight home.
